aboutsummaryrefslogtreecommitdiff
path: root/examples/ramfunc.rs
diff options
context:
space:
mode:
authorPer Lindgren <per.lindgren@ltu.se>2023-01-07 17:59:39 +0100
committerHenrik Tjäder <henrik@tjaders.com>2023-03-01 00:33:24 +0100
commit9a4f97ca5ebf19e6612115db5c763d0d61dd28a1 (patch)
tree1f37d247f715ad3d5215aa7de3aa6d4eb94a7027 /examples/ramfunc.rs
parent5606ba3cf38c80be5d3e9c88ad4da9982b114851 (diff)
more examples
Diffstat (limited to 'examples/ramfunc.rs')
-rw-r--r--examples/ramfunc.rs10
1 files changed, 5 insertions, 5 deletions
diff --git a/examples/ramfunc.rs b/examples/ramfunc.rs
index b3b8012..dd1f76e 100644
--- a/examples/ramfunc.rs
+++ b/examples/ramfunc.rs
@@ -3,7 +3,7 @@
#![deny(warnings)]
#![no_main]
#![no_std]
-
+#![feature(type_alias_impl_trait)]
use panic_semihosting as _;
#[rtic::app(
@@ -24,15 +24,15 @@ mod app {
struct Local {}
#[init]
- fn init(_: init::Context) -> (Shared, Local, init::Monotonics) {
+ fn init(_: init::Context) -> (Shared, Local) {
foo::spawn().unwrap();
- (Shared {}, Local {}, init::Monotonics())
+ (Shared {}, Local {})
}
#[inline(never)]
#[task]
- fn foo(_: foo::Context) {
+ async fn foo(_: foo::Context) {
hprintln!("foo").unwrap();
debug::exit(debug::EXIT_SUCCESS); // Exit QEMU simulator
@@ -42,7 +42,7 @@ mod app {
#[inline(never)]
#[link_section = ".data.bar"]
#[task(priority = 2)]
- fn bar(_: bar::Context) {
+ async fn bar(_: bar::Context) {
foo::spawn().unwrap();
}
}